In this episode, we dive deep into the journey of a podcaster who transitioned from freelancing to becoming a successful real estate investor. Initially struggling to make money from podcasting, Trevor Oldham started freelancing, offering services like podcast editing and guest booking. This eventually led to a pivotal partnership with a real estate investor in LA, setting the stage for a growing business and the first employee hire.
Fast forward to today, Trevor focuses exclusively on the real estate niche, building a thriving company by helping investors get booked on podcasts. Inspired by the investors he worked with, he ventured into real estate investments himself, starting with a modest $500 in a mortgage note fund. His investments grew over time, leading to multiple deals across different asset classes, including triple net leases and mobile home parks.
Listen in as he shares insights on the importance of cash flow, the benefits of being a limited partner, and his strategy for building a steady stream of passive income. This episode is a must-listen for anyone interested in real estate investing, whether you're just starting out or looking to diversify your portfolio.
More about Trevor:
In 2017, Trevor Oldham created Podcasting You in response to the necessity for outstanding real estate investors to have the opportunity to spread their narrative on high-ranking podcasts. So far, Podcasting You has worked with 400+ real estate professionals and booked 6,500+ interviews.
Trevor himself is committed to a NNN Deal, Multifamily, and Self-Storage Development Deal, in addition to investing in mortgage notes and continually enlarging his real estate portfolio.
